The Judo Chop Suey Podcast is a show that discusses International Judo Federation results, topics, techniques, history, and opinion on all things related to Judo. Dave Roman currently holds the rank of nidan in Judo and has been a practitioner of Judo for 18 years. Other grappling sports and topics may be covered from time to time, most notably on Brazilian Jiu Jitsu where Dave also holds the rank of blue belt.

Happy New Year! The International Judo Federation updated their rules for the upcoming Olympic cycle. Judo Dave is going to give his thoughts on what this means for you and for Judo moving forward. Plus, big news concerning USA Judo and a former Olympic winner finds himself in legal trouble.
New Rules for the next Olympic Cycle between 2022-2024. [6:31]
Is the IJF ruining Judo? [32:00]
USA Judo partners with American Judo. [37:16]
Tragic news concerning 2008 gold winning Olympian. [40:24]
